
Can fish eat beef? It's an intriguing question that may seem contradictory at first. After all, we often associate fish with a diet that consists mainly of marine life and plants. However, it turns out that some fish species can actually consume beef and other types of meat. This behavior is known as piscivory, and while it is not common among all fish, there are certain species that have adapted to include meat in their diet. So, let's dive deeper into the world of fish diets and explore this fascinating concept of fish eating beef.
Characteristics | Values |
---|---|
Protein | High |
Fat | Low |
Calories | Medium |
Iron | High |
Vitamin B12 | High |
Omega-3 fatty acids | Low |
Zinc | High |
Vitamin D | Low |
Vitamin E | Low |
Vitamin A | Low |
Vitamin K | Low |
What You'll Learn
Can fish eat beef as a part of their natural diet?
When it comes to the dietary preferences of fish, the answer to whether they can eat beef as a part of their natural diet is not a simple yes or no. While fish are generally considered opportunistic feeders and can consume a wide variety of food sources, including other fish, insects, crustaceans, and plants, beef is not a component that is typically found in their natural diet.
In the wild, fish have evolved to thrive on a diet that is specific to their species and the surrounding ecosystem. For example, carnivorous fish such as pike or largemouth bass primarily feed on other fish, while herbivorous fish like tilapia or koi primarily consume plants and algae. This specialization in diet is due to their physiological adaptations and digestive systems.
Beef, being a meat product derived from land animals, is not readily available in the natural habitats of fish. Fish lack the necessary digestive enzymes and mechanisms to efficiently process and digest meat sources like beef. In comparison to mammals, fish have a shorter digestive tract that limits their ability to extract nutrients from complex proteins found in meat.
However, in controlled aquaculture settings or home aquariums, some fish species can be fed with beef or other meat-based products as a part of their diet. This is often done for specific reasons, such as providing a supplemental source of protein or introducing a varied diet. In these cases, the beef needs to be properly processed and prepared to ensure it is safe and digestible for the fish.
One common method used to incorporate beef into a fish's diet is by grinding it into fine particles or flakes. This allows the fish to consume the meat more easily and increases the surface area available for digestion. Some fish species, especially omnivorous or piscivorous ones, may readily accept beef as a part of their diet and show no adverse effects.
However, it's important to note that not all fish species can tolerate or digest beef effectively. Some fish have a more sensitive digestive system and may experience digestive problems or health issues when fed with meat-based products. Additionally, feeding fish an unbalanced diet that includes too much meat can lead to nutritional deficiencies and imbalance in their overall health.
In conclusion, while fish in the wild do not typically encounter beef as a part of their natural diet, some fish species can consume it in controlled environments. However, it is important to exercise caution and ensure that the beef is properly prepared and offered in moderation. Each fish species has specific dietary requirements, and it is essential to research and understand their natural feeding habits to ensure their health and well-being in captivity.
Can a Fish Eat Other Fish: Understanding the Predator-Prey Relationship in the Water
You may want to see also
Are there any benefits or risks associated with feeding fish beef?
Feeding fish beef is a controversial practice that has both benefits and risks associated with it. While it may seem unusual to feed land-based animals to aquatic creatures, there are reasons why some fishkeepers choose to do so. However, it is important to weigh these potential benefits against the potential risks.
One of the main benefits of feeding fish beef is the added protein content. Beef is a rich source of protein, which is vital for the growth and development of fish. Many fish species require a high-protein diet to support their metabolic processes and maintain their overall health. By incorporating beef into their diet, fishkeepers can ensure that their fish are getting the necessary nutrients to thrive.
In addition to protein, beef also contains essential amino acids that can be beneficial for fish. These amino acids are building blocks of proteins and play a crucial role in various physiological processes, such as growth, reproduction, and immune system function. By providing these amino acids through beef, fishkeepers can support the overall well-being of their fish.
However, there are also potential risks associated with feeding fish beef. One concern is the potential introduction of pathogens or parasites to the aquatic environment. Beef can be a source of bacteria such as E. coli or Salmonella, which can be harmful to fish. If the beef is not properly handled, cooked, or processed, it may contain these pathogens, which can then infect the fish.
Another risk is the potential imbalance of nutrients in the fish's diet. While beef is high in protein, it may lack other essential nutrients that fish require. Fish have specific dietary needs that must be met to ensure their overall health and growth. By relying solely on beef as a food source, fishkeepers may inadvertently deprive their fish of other necessary nutrients, leading to malnutrition or health issues.
It is also worth noting that feeding fish beef can be a costly and unsustainable practice. Beef is a valuable food source for human consumption, and diverting it to fish may contribute to food scarcity or price increases. Additionally, the beef industry has significant environmental impacts, such as deforestation and greenhouse gas emissions. By supporting this industry through fish feeding practices, fishkeepers may inadvertently contribute to these negative environmental effects.
In conclusion, feeding fish beef can have both benefits and risks. While it can provide an additional protein source and essential amino acids, there are concerns about pathogen introduction, nutrient imbalances, and the sustainability of this practice. It is essential for fishkeepers to carefully consider these factors and seek alternative, sustainable sources of nutrition for their fish. Consulting with aquatic veterinarians or experts in fish nutrition can help ensure the health and well-being of the fish while minimizing potential risks.
Can Big Goldfish Eat Small Fish? The Truth Revealed
You may want to see also
What types of fish are more likely to consume beef?
Fish are known for their diverse diets, which can range from plant matter to smaller fish and invertebrates. However, there are some species of fish that are more likely to consume beef or any other type of meat. Understanding the preferences of these fish can be useful for anglers and fish enthusiasts. In this article, we will explore what types of fish are more likely to consume beef, and why this may be the case.
- Piranhas: One of the most well-known fish species that consume meat is the piranha. Piranhas are native to South American rivers and are notorious for their sharp teeth and scavenging habits. While they mostly feed on fish and invertebrates, they have been known to consume meat, including beef. This behavior is more common in captivity, where they are often fed with a variety of meats for better nutrition.
- Catfish: Another group of fish that are more likely to consume beef are catfish. Catfish are bottom-dwelling fish that have a varied diet, which can include small fish, worms, insects, and vegetation. In some instances, catfish have been observed to scavenge and consume pieces of dead animals, including beef. This behavior is more common in larger species of catfish that have the capacity to consume larger prey.
- Barracuda: Barracudas are large, predatory fish that are found in tropical oceans around the world. Known for their fierce hunting abilities, barracudas primarily feed on smaller fish. However, they are opportunistic feeders and have been observed to consume a wide range of prey, including meat. Although it is not their preferred food source, barracudas have been known to bite into bait made with beef and other meats.
- Pike: Pike is a freshwater fish species that is known for its aggressive behavior and predatory nature. They primarily feed on smaller fish, but they also have a reputation for consuming larger prey, including small mammals and birds. While beef is not their natural food source, pike have been known to strike at meaty baits, especially if they are presented in a way that mimics injured prey.
- Sharks: Sharks are apex predators that have a wide menu of prey options. While their natural diet consists of fish, seals, and sea lions, there have been instances where sharks have consumed meat, including beef. This behavior is more commonly observed in captivity, where sharks may be fed with various types of meat for nutritional purposes.
It's important to note that while these fish may consume beef or other types of meat, it is not a natural or essential part of their diet. Their feeding habits vary depending on their environment and availability of prey. In the wild, their primary food sources are typically fish, invertebrates, and other marine life.
In conclusion, there are several types of fish that are more likely to consume beef, including piranhas, catfish, barracudas, pike, and certain species of sharks. This behavior is more commonly observed in captivity or when presented with meaty baits that mimic injured prey. However, it's important to remember that these fish primarily rely on their natural food sources for proper nutrition and survival.
Can Betta Fish Eat Leaves? A Guide to Feeding Your Siamese Fighting Fish
You may want to see also
How should beef be prepared before feeding it to fish?
Preparing beef before feeding it to fish is an important step to ensure the health and well-being of the fish. Beef can be a valuable source of protein and nutrients for fish, but it must be properly prepared to ensure it is safe for consumption.
Firstly, it is crucial to choose the right type of beef for feeding fish. Lean cuts of beef such as sirloin or tenderloin are preferable, as they contain less fat and connective tissue. This is important because excessive fat can cause digestive issues for fish, and tough connective tissue can be difficult for them to break down and digest.
Once the appropriate cut of beef has been selected, it should be thoroughly washed and cleaned. This helps to remove any potential contaminants or bacteria that may be present on the surface of the meat. It is important to use clean, potable water for this step to avoid introducing any harmful substances to the beef.
After washing, the beef should be cut into small, bite-sized pieces. This allows the fish to easily consume and digest the meat. The size of the pieces will depend on the size and species of the fish being fed. For smaller fish, such as tetras or guppies, tiny pieces of beef should be provided. Larger fish, such as cichlids or catfish, can handle slightly larger chunks.
Before feeding the beef to the fish, it is important to freeze it for a period of time to kill any potential parasites that may be present. Freezing the meat for at least 48 hours at a temperature of -4°F (-20°C) is generally sufficient to eliminate any parasites. This step is especially crucial for raw or lightly cooked beef, as these preparations may not kill all parasites.
Once the beef has been properly prepared and frozen, it can be offered to the fish. It is important to feed only the amount of beef that the fish can consume in a few minutes to avoid overfeeding and water pollution. Overfeeding can lead to poor water quality, excessive waste, and potential health issues for the fish.
Feeding beef to fish can provide them with a valuable source of protein and nutrients. However, it is important to only feed beef as a supplemental part of their diet and not as their primary source of food. Fish require a varied diet that includes other protein sources, such as fish pellets or live foods.
In conclusion, preparing beef before feeding it to fish is crucial to ensure the health and well-being of the fish. Choosing the right type of beef, thoroughly washing and cleaning it, cutting it into appropriate sizes, freezing to kill parasites, and feeding the correct amount are all important steps in this process. By following these steps, fish can safely enjoy the nutritional benefits of beef as part of a balanced diet.
Can Catfish Thrive on Store-Bought Fish Food?
You may want to see also
How does feeding fish beef impact their overall health and growth?
Feeding fish a diet that includes beef as a significant portion can have both positive and negative impacts on their overall health and growth. While fish are naturally carnivorous and can derive essential nutrients from animal protein sources, it is important to carefully balance their diet to avoid potential issues.
One of the main benefits of feeding fish beef is the high protein content. Protein is crucial for fish growth and development, and beef is a rich source of this essential nutrient. When fish consume beef, their bodies break down the proteins into amino acids, which are then used to build and repair tissues, produce enzymes and hormones, and support various physiological functions.
In addition to protein, beef also contains important vitamins and minerals that can positively affect fish health. For example, beef is a significant source of vitamin B12, which plays a vital role in the formation of red blood cells and the maintenance of a healthy nervous system in fish. Beef also contains minerals like iron and zinc, which are important for immune function and overall wellbeing.
However, feeding fish too much beef can have negative consequences. First of all, fish primarily thrive on diets that reflect their natural feeding habits. While some fish species are more omnivorous, others are strictly herbivorous or piscivorous. Feeding fish large amounts of beef can disrupt their natural dietary balance and lead to digestive problems. Furthermore, depending on the origin and processing of the beef, there is a risk of contaminating the fish with antibiotics and other chemicals that may be used in livestock farming.
To mitigate these risks, it is important to carefully formulate fish diets that include the appropriate amount of beef protein while also considering the specific needs of the fish species in question. This can be achieved through a combination of commercially available fish feeds and carefully selected natural ingredients. Fish feeds that are specially formulated for carnivorous fish species often contain a balanced blend of animal proteins, including sources like fish meal and shrimp meal, which closely mimic the natural prey of these fish. By using these types of feeds as a basis and supplementing with small amounts of beef as a protein source, fish can enjoy the benefits of animal protein while minimizing the potential risks associated with overfeeding.
In conclusion, feeding fish beef can positively impact their overall health and growth by providing a rich source of protein, vitamins, and minerals. However, it is important to balance their diet and consider their natural feeding habits to avoid potential digestive issues and contamination. By carefully formulating fish diets and using a combination of commercial feeds and natural ingredients, fish can thrive on a diet that includes beef protein while also meeting their specific nutritional needs.
Can Betta Fish Survive on Eating Once a Day?
You may want to see also
Frequently asked questions
Fish are primarily omnivorous, meaning they can consume both plant and animal matter. While some species of fish may occasionally eat small amounts of beef or other types of meat, it is not a natural or recommended part of their diet. Fish are more suited to eating a diet that consists of fish meal, shrimp, insects, and other aquatic organisms.
Feeding fish a diet that includes beef poses several risks. Beef is high in fats and proteins that can be difficult for fish to digest. The consumption of beef can also lead to an imbalance in the fish's nutritional intake, as they are not adapted to metabolize the same nutrients as land animals. Additionally, incorporating beef into a fish's diet may introduce harmful bacteria or parasites that could harm the fish.
If fish consume beef, they may experience digestive issues such as bloating, constipation, or even digestive tract blockages. The high fat content in beef can overwhelm a fish's digestive system, leading to inflammation or other health problems. In some cases, the consumption of beef can also lead to nutrient deficiencies or imbalances, negatively impacting the overall health and wellbeing of the fish.
The best diet for fish varies depending on the species. In general, most fish species thrive on a diet that includes a mix of commercially available fish pellets or flakes, live or frozen food such as brine shrimp or bloodworms, and fresh or frozen vegetables. It is best to consult with a veterinarian or a knowledgeable fish expert to determine the specific nutritional needs of your fish species and provide a balanced and appropriate diet.
2 Comments
Alicia Berger
Damaris Snow